What is a Wall Chaser?
A wall chaser, also referred to as a wall groove cutting machine, is a customized tool that creates neat, precise cavities in walls. It uses two parallel diamond blades to cut a groove into different materials, consisting of concrete, brick, and masonry. Developed to manage hard products, the wall chaser is an important resource for builders looking to attain professional surfaces in wall modification tasks.

How to Use a Wall Chaser Effectively
Utilizing a wall chaser might seem straightforward, but following an organized technique improves safety and efficiency. Here's a step-by-step guide:
Step 1: Preparation
Step and Flachdübelfräse Test 2024 Mark: Use a measuring tape to determine the exact location for the groove. Mark the lays out with a pencil.

Gather Tools: Ensure that you have the wall chaser, safety goggles, dust mask, and hearing protection.
Action 2: Set Up the Wall Chaser
Adjust Depth: Determine the required cutting depth and change the blade settings on the tool.

Examine Blades: Ensure the diamond blades are sharp and appropriately lined up.
Action 3: Safety FirstWear Protective Gear: Always wear safety goggles and a dust mask to protect versus inhalation of dust particles or flying debris.Step 4: Cutting the Groove
Position the Chaser: Align the wall chaser with the significant line.

Start With Light Pressure: Turn on the machine and start cutting the groove, using light pressure to let the tool do the work.

Follow the Mark: Maintain a constant hand and follow the marked lines to make sure precision.

Dust Management: If your model accommodates a vacuum accessory, ensure it's functional to gather dust as you cut.
Step 5: Final Touches
Clean the Area: Once the cutting is done, clean up particles and dust from the work location.

Examine the Groove: Ensure the grooves are the correct depth and width for your particular task requirements.
Common Applications of Wall Chasers
Circuitry Installations: Perfect for embedding electrical wires into walls without impacting structural stability.

Plumbing Work: Ideal for producing channels for pipes in concrete walls.

Cooling And Heating Systems: Facilitates the installation of duct systems that require accurate grooves.

Remodellings and Remodeling: Simplifies the process of modifying existing structures.
Maintenance Tips for Wall Chasers
Routine Cleaning: Clean the blades and machine to secure against dust accumulation.

Inspect Blade Condition: Inspect for wear and tear, changing blades as needed.

Shop Properly: Keep in a dry place to prevent rusting or damage to electronic elements.
